This property is 1/2 of a '50's-era house that serves as a residence when not rented out. The host was very helpful and accommodating, answering all my questions promptly, and even allowing me to check in a couple of hours early. Everything was clean and functional, and there is a gazebo in which I could secure my bike and keep it out of the weather. The kitchen reflects the age of the house, with a remarkable turquoise wall oven, but is well-equipped. Due to space requirements, the microwave is on a bookshelf in the adjoining great room. The great room has a wide variety of fiction and nonfiction books with popular titles that range back to the '70's, and contains an old upright grand piano that you are invited to play. If you are a fan of older movies, there is an extensive collection of movies on VHS tape and the player to go with, along with DVD's etc. The bathroom is a bit dated but functional. The single small bedroom is essentially filled by a queen-size bed, with a wall closet. As you may know, Yellow Springs is a pretty fun little town, and it's walking distance to the downtown. Overall, it's a more utilitarian property suited to people such as myself spending a few days hiking and biking, or biking through, as opposed to a 'romantic couples weekend', so 4 stars instead of 5.
